Class GameStateChangeS2CPacket
java.lang.Object
net.minecraft.network.packet.s2c.play.GameStateChangeS2CPacket
- All Implemented Interfaces:
Packet<ClientPlayPacketListener>
public class GameStateChangeS2CPacket extends Object implements Packet<ClientPlayPacketListener>
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
GameStateChangeS2CPacket.Reason
-
Field Summary
Fields Modifier and Type Field Description static GameStateChangeS2CPacket.Reason
DEMO_MESSAGE_SHOWN
static GameStateChangeS2CPacket.Reason
ELDER_GUARDIAN_EFFECT
static GameStateChangeS2CPacket.Reason
GAME_MODE_CHANGED
static GameStateChangeS2CPacket.Reason
GAME_WON
static GameStateChangeS2CPacket.Reason
IMMEDIATE_RESPAWN
static GameStateChangeS2CPacket.Reason
NO_RESPAWN_BLOCK
static GameStateChangeS2CPacket.Reason
PROJECTILE_HIT_PLAYER
static GameStateChangeS2CPacket.Reason
PUFFERFISH_STING
static GameStateChangeS2CPacket.Reason
RAIN_GRADIENT_CHANGED
static GameStateChangeS2CPacket.Reason
RAIN_STARTED
static GameStateChangeS2CPacket.Reason
RAIN_STOPPED
private GameStateChangeS2CPacket.Reason
reason
static GameStateChangeS2CPacket.Reason
THUNDER_GRADIENT_CHANGED
private float
value
-
Constructor Summary
Constructors Constructor Description GameStateChangeS2CPacket()
GameStateChangeS2CPacket(GameStateChangeS2CPacket.Reason reason, float value)
-
Method Summary
Modifier and Type Method Description void
apply(ClientPlayPacketListener clientPlayPacketListener)
GameStateChangeS2CPacket.Reason
getReason()
float
getValue()
void
read(PacketByteBuf buf)
void
write(PacketByteBuf buf)
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face net.minecraft.network.Packet
isWritingErrorSkippable
-
Field Details
-
NO_RESPAWN_BLOCK
-
RAIN_STARTED
-
RAIN_STOPPED
-
GAME_MODE_CHANGED
-
GAME_WON
-
DEMO_MESSAGE_SHOWN
-
PROJECTILE_HIT_PLAYER
-
RAIN_GRADIENT_CHANGED
-
THUNDER_GRADIENT_CHANGED
-
PUFFERFISH_STING
-
ELDER_GUARDIAN_EFFECT
-
IMMEDIATE_RESPAWN
-
reason
-
value
private float value
-
-
Constructor Details
-
GameStateChangeS2CPacket
public GameStateChangeS2CPacket() -
GameStateChangeS2CPacket
-
-
Method Details
-
read
- Specified by:
read
in interfacePacket<ClientPlayPacketListener>
- Throws:
IOException
-
write
- Specified by:
write
in interfacePacket<ClientPlayPacketListener>
- Throws:
IOException
-
apply
- Specified by:
apply
in interfacePacket<ClientPlayPacketListener>
-
getReason
-
getValue
@Environment(CLIENT) public float getValue()
-